On April 23-24, Baku will host the 2nd Annual Caspian and Central Asia Oil Trading and Logistics Forum, a key event for energy and transport market participants, Report informs.
The event will take place against the backdrop of the growing role of the Middle Corridor in the current geopolitical landscape, which is becoming a critical route for crude oil, petroleum products, and petrochemicals between East and West.
The forum will bring together leading industry representatives, including senior executives from the State Oil Company of Azerbaijan (SOCAR), Petronas, KMG Kashagan, Pakistan Railways, and the Black Sea Terminal.
Discussions will focus on developing sustainable logistics routes between East and West, expanding Caspian infrastructure, managing geopolitical risks, and implementing unified trade cooperation mechanisms.
The forum will serve as a key platform for developing practical solutions and strengthening the region's role as a strategic energy bridge between Asia and Europe.
